A powerful debut from Irish hip-hop.
The hard beats and aggressive lyrics made a big impact.
House of Pain's self-titled debut album was released in 1992. Their signature song "Jump Around" was a huge hit on the US charts and is known as a party anthem that symbolizes 90s hip-hop. Their identity and raw sound, rooted in Irish immigrant culture, brought a breath of fresh air to the hip-hop scene at the time.
